Suzuki - Alto (2012)
Suzuki Alto – a timeless entry‑level sedan that has become a staple for city commuters since its debut in 2007. The 2012 Suzuki Alto continues that legacy, offering a compact footprint, efficient powertrain, and a reputation for low ownership costs. Whether you’re wondering what is a 2012 Suzuki Alto worth, looking for used Suzuki Alto price data, or just curious about the Suzuki Alto depreciation curve, this overview provides a clear snapshot of what to expect in the current market.
- Engine: 1.0‑litre, 3‑cyl, 85 hp & 98 Nm torque
- Transmission: 5‑speed manual (automatic available in select trims)
- Fuel type: Petrol
- Fuel economy: ~22 km/l in city, ~20 km/l on highways (varies by drive style)
- Dimensions: Length: 3,600 mm, Width: 1,635 mm, Height: 1,470 mm
- Wheelbase: 2,200 mm, providing a surprisingly spacious cabin for a sub‑compact
- Weight: ~930 kg (depending on trim and equipment level)
- Top speed: 113 km/h
- 0–100 km/h acceleration: ~14.5 seconds
These specs illustrate why the Suzuki Alto remains one of the most popular choice for first‑time buyers and city dwellers. Its small size offers maneuverability, while the modest powerpack keeps maintenance dashboards tidy and affordable.
Depreciation Insight
New vehicles experience a sharp drop within the first year, and the Suzuki Alto depreciation trend aligns with that industry norm. Here’s what you can expect if you buy or sell in a typical open‑market environment:
- First year: 15–20 % of original MSRP
- Second year: 10–12 % additional depreciation (cumulative ~25–30 %)
- Beyond the second year: 5–7 % annually, tapering to ~1–3 % per year once the vehicle reaches 5–6 years
Because the Alto sits in the highly competitive budget segment, the depreciation curve is comparatively steep but stabilizes faster once the vehicle is well‑established on the road. That means a pre‑owned used Suzuki Alto price in 2021 or 2022 is usually still attractive for buyers seeking a low‑cost commuter.
